Pop star Ariana Grande has been teasing new music since the beginning of the year, so fans have obviously been getting super excited, and earlier this week a source told Variety we should expect new music from her on the 27th April.

Since the date was 'revealed' fans of the pop star have been speculating as to what it could be called. And seemingly adding to the hype, Ariana recently took to her Instagram Story to tease her new music, but subsequently removed the post!

What could this all mean?

According to an Ariana fan account, which posted a screengrab of her Instagram Story, Ariana posted a photo with the handwritten words 'No tears left to cry', captioned, 'None of this would be possible without my amazing team. Soon babes <3'.

Some of the pop star's fans also spotted the singer wearing a top with the same words, on a recent trip to Disneyland, posting the photo on Twitter.

Although Ariana's Instagram Story is no longer available it is widely thought that her new single will be called 'No Tears Left To Cry' and will be featured on her forthcoming fourth studio album.

At this stage it is all speculation, however one fan's tweet, where he puts together the 'evidence' for the new single has received over 4K likes.

Other than posting to her Instragram Story, Ariana has been quiet on her social channels, with her last post on Instagram being late last year. She has however appeared on other singer's Instagram pages, including Dua Lipa's.

Back in January, Dua posted a photo of the pair on Instagram with just an emoji as a caption, '💕', fuelling rumours the pair could be due to release a collaboration.

Four months later and a very short clip has been leaked online, thought to be the collaboration between the pair. This clip, which has been circulating on social media, is thought to be called 'Bad To You', obviously different to the latest apparent tease.

However, nothing has yet been confirmed by either singer, so it looks like we might have to wait until the 27th April for more to be revealed.

The follow-up to her 2016 album 'Dangerous Woman' is expected to include collaborations from Max Martin and Pharrell Williams amongst others. It is believed that the album is a deeply personal album, inspired by the singer's experiences over the past two years, including the Manchester bombing on the 19th May 2017, which happened after one of her concerts at the Manchester Arena.
